CharlotteRising is encouraging everyone interested in the continued rejuvenation of downtown Charlotte to attend a Community Reunion next week, August 24, at the historic Beach Market. The event will begin at 6:30 p.m.
CharlotteRising was formed 5 years ago as downtown Charlotte’s Michigan Main Street organization. Since that time, it has championed the redevelopment of the city’s downtown commercial district through active volunteerism, practical public/private partnerships, strategic grant-seeking, generous grand-making, and a host of big and small revitalization activities.
After a whirlwind first three years, CharlotteRising spent the next two years working to connect Charlotte businesses to Covid relief resources, making sure that no stone was left unturned and no opportunity left unexplored. In the end, downtown Charlotte emerged as strong as ever.
